Here's a specific technology that's going to be a huge boon to robotics in the next 5-10 years: Flash LIDAR cameras. This is the technology behind the XBox 360's "Project Natal", but it's a lot more than a game controller. A Flash LIDAR camera directly senses the distance to every object seen by the camera by measuring the time-of-flight of a reflected laser pulse. With accurate distance data for every pixel a lot of really hard computer vision problems suddenly become much, much eaiser.
